Brookshire Bros. Transitioning To eGrowcery Digital Tools

Brookshire Bros. eGrowcery

Brookshire Bros., a regional grocery chain in Texas and western Louisiana, is deploying digital tools from eGrowcery for its online ordering and fulfillment operations. 

The transition to the new platform, which will be seamless to Brookshire Bros.’ customers, will launch Jan. 1.

Some enhanced features shoppers can expect include integrated coupon clipping and redemption, complex promotions and several other aesthetic improvements.

In addition, Brookshire Bros. will deploy a more efficient picking and fulfillment technology suite, which is expected to save the company labor time and money, through eGrowcery’s integrated fulfillment approach.

“The eGrowcery platform offers a deeper integration with the systems and strategies that we go to market with every day,” said John Alston, CEO and president of Brookshire Bros.

“The customer will benefit from being able to use digital coupons and navigate promotional savings while our store team optimizes the picking process to help save time and money.”

Personal shopping experts select the highest quality products, and the new e-commerce platform supports the two-way conversation between shopper and customer.

Operating in the U.S. and abroad, eGrowcery said it is seeing an increasing number of retailers transition to its white-label platform.

CEO Patrick Hughes said the company is “honored to work with the great team at Brookshire Bros.”

“We are committed to providing their team with a comprehensive and scalable digital solution today, but also look forward to partnering in developing new features to continually improve shopper adoption rates and basket size growth,” he said. “Our ‘Team Grow’ is committed to their success as much as they are our own.”

About Brookshire Brothers

Brookshire Bros. is an employee-owned, community-centered grocer based in Lufkin, Texas. Founded in 1921, it operates about 120 locations that stretch west to the Texas Hill Country and east to Lake Charles, Louisiana. 

The company also has complimentary formats that include fuel and tobacco operations, coffee shops and event venues.
